The Multimedia Photojournalism major prepares students to work as visual journalists in a competitive new media environment. Students
learn photojournalism and video storytelling, with a special emphasis on audio, documentary and interactive media. The program is
grounded in the foundations of journalism and photography while recognizing the need for students to be innovators, crossing platforms to
tell stories. Students have opportunities to pick from a wide range of electives, including courses in blogging, coding, documentary and
interactive media. Columbia College Chicago is uniquely and ideally suited to offer this degree with its diverse range of media art specialities
in media management, photography, television, journalism, cinema and radio. The program culiminates with a capstone experience in which
students work in a digital newsroom to produce portfolio work ranging from photographic essays to short-form documentary.
The Multimedia Photojournalism major requires 44 credits in Multimedia Photojournalism to complete this major. In each course
necessary to fulfill the Multimedia Photojournalism requirements, students must earn a minimum grade of "C." Students must also complete
the Liberal Arts and Sciences Core Curriculum (42 credits) and a balance of College-Wide Electives to total at least 120 credits for the
Bachelor of Arts degree.
